Sidewalk Owners - Riddle Me This

I may have uncovered something...on the Mini website when you go to BUILD, under STEP 2 it clearly states that the Sidewalk Package will add "Our Sport and Premium Packages" and then when you look at the Sport Package it clearly says it includes Bonnet Stripes.

So why then did we all PAY for Bonnet stripes??????

866-ASK-MINI rep chuckled & told me to talk to the dealer...wish me luck!!!!
